| 1 |
# |
| 2 |
# @(#)psfontj2d.properties 1.1 99/11/04 |
| 3 |
# |
| 4 |
# Copyright 1999 by Sun Microsystems, Inc., |
| 5 |
# 901 San Antonio Road, Palo Alto, California, 94303, U.S.A. |
| 6 |
# All rights reserved. |
| 7 |
# |
| 8 |
# This software is the confidential and proprietary information |
| 9 |
# of Sun Microsystems, Inc. ("Confidential Information"). You |
| 10 |
# shall not disclose such Confidential Information and shall use |
| 11 |
# it only in accordance with the terms of the license agreement |
| 12 |
# you entered into with Sun. |
| 13 |
# |
| 14 |
|
| 15 |
# |
| 16 |
# PostScript printer property file for Java 2D printing. |
| 17 |
# |
| 18 |
# WARNING: This is an internal implementation file, not a public file. |
| 19 |
# Any customisation or reliance on the existence of this file and its |
| 20 |
# contents or syntax is discouraged and unsupported. |
| 21 |
# It may be incompatibly changed or removed without any notice. |
| 22 |
# |
| 23 |
# |
| 24 |
font.num=35 |
| 25 |
# |
| 26 |
# Legacy logical font family names and logical font aliases should all |
| 27 |
# map to the primary logical font names. |
| 28 |
# |
| 29 |
serif=serif |
| 30 |
times=serif |
| 31 |
timesroman=serif |
| 32 |
sansserif=sansserif |
| 33 |
helvetica=sansserif |
| 34 |
dialog=sansserif |
| 35 |
dialoginput=monospaced |
| 36 |
monospaced=monospaced |
| 37 |
courier=monospaced |
| 38 |
# |
| 39 |
# Next, physical fonts which can be safely mapped to standard postscript fonts |
| 40 |
# These keys generally map to a value which is the same as the key, so |
| 41 |
# the key/value is just a way to say the font has a mapping. |
| 42 |
# Sometimes however we map more than one screen font to the same PS font. |
| 43 |
# |
| 44 |
avantgarde=avantgarde_book |
| 45 |
avantgarde_book=avantgarde_book |
| 46 |
avantgarde_demi=avantgarde_demi |
| 47 |
avantgarde_book_oblique=avantgarde_book_oblique |
| 48 |
avantgarde_demi_oblique=avantgarde_demi_oblique |
| 49 |
# |
| 50 |
itcavantgarde=avantgarde_book |
| 51 |
itcavantgarde=avantgarde_book |
| 52 |
itcavantgarde_demi=avantgarde_demi |
| 53 |
itcavantgarde_oblique=avantgarde_book_oblique |
| 54 |
itcavantgarde_demi_oblique=avantgarde_demi_oblique |
| 55 |
# |
| 56 |
bookman=bookman_light |
| 57 |
bookman_light=bookman_light |
| 58 |
bookman_demi=bookman_demi |
| 59 |
bookman_light_italic=bookman_light_italic |
| 60 |
bookman_demi_italic=bookman_demi_italic |
| 61 |
# |
| 62 |
# Exclude "helvetica" on its own as that's a legacy name for a logical font |
| 63 |
helvetica_bold=helvetica_bold |
| 64 |
helvetica_oblique=helvetica_oblique |
| 65 |
helvetica_bold_oblique=helvetica_bold_oblique |
| 66 |
# |
| 67 |
itcbookman_light=bookman_light |
| 68 |
itcbookman_demi=bookman_demi |
| 69 |
itcbookman_light_italic=bookman_light_italic |
| 70 |
itcbookman_demi_italic=bookman_demi_italic |
| 71 |
# |
| 72 |
# Exclude "courier" on its own as that's a legacy name for a logical font |
| 73 |
courier_bold=courier_bold |
| 74 |
courier_oblique=courier_oblique |
| 75 |
courier_bold_oblique=courier_bold_oblique |
| 76 |
# |
| 77 |
courier_new=courier |
| 78 |
courier_new_bold=courier_bold |
| 79 |
# |
| 80 |
monotype_century_schoolbook=newcenturyschoolbook |
| 81 |
monotype_century_schoolbook_bold=newcenturyschoolbook_bold |
| 82 |
monotype_century_schoolbook_italic=newcenturyschoolbook_italic |
| 83 |
monotype_century_schoolbook_bold_italic=newcenturyschoolbook_bold_italic |
| 84 |
# |
| 85 |
newcenturyschoolbook=newcenturyschoolbook |
| 86 |
newcenturyschoolbook_bold=newcenturyschoolbook_bold |
| 87 |
newcenturyschoolbook_italic=newcenturyschoolbook_italic |
| 88 |
newcenturyschoolbook_bold_italic=newcenturyschoolbook_bold_italic |
| 89 |
# |
| 90 |
palatino=palatino |
| 91 |
palatino_bold=palatino_bold |
| 92 |
palatino_italic=palatino_italic |
| 93 |
palatino_bold_italic=palatino_bold_italic |
| 94 |
# |
| 95 |
# Exclude "times" on its own as that's a legacy name for a logical font |
| 96 |
times_bold=times_roman_bold |
| 97 |
times_italic=times_roman_italic |
| 98 |
times_bold_italic=times_roman_bold_italic |
| 99 |
# |
| 100 |
times_roman=times_roman |
| 101 |
times_roman_bold=times_roman_bold |
| 102 |
times_roman_italic=times_roman_italic |
| 103 |
times_roman_bold_italic=times_roman_bold_italic |
| 104 |
# |
| 105 |
times_new_roman=times_roman |
| 106 |
times_new_roman_bold=times_roman_bold |
| 107 |
times_new_roman_italic=times_roman_italic |
| 108 |
times_new_roman_bold_italic=times_roman_bold_italic |
| 109 |
# |
| 110 |
zapfchancery_italic=zapfchancery_italic |
| 111 |
itczapfchancery_italic=zapfchancery_italic |
| 112 |
# |
| 113 |
# Next the mapping of the font name + charset + style to Postscript font name |
| 114 |
# for the logical fonts. |
| 115 |
# |
| 116 |
serif.latin1.plain=Times-Roman |
| 117 |
serif.latin1.bold=Times-Bold |
| 118 |
serif.latin1.italic=Times-Italic |
| 119 |
serif.latin1.bolditalic=Times-BoldItalic |
| 120 |
serif.symbol.plain=Symbol |
| 121 |
serif.dingbats.plain=ZapfDingbats |
| 122 |
serif.symbol.bold=Symbol |
| 123 |
serif.dingbats.bold=ZapfDingbats |
| 124 |
serif.symbol.italic=Symbol |
| 125 |
serif.dingbats.italic=ZapfDingbats |
| 126 |
serif.symbol.bolditalic=Symbol |
| 127 |
serif.dingbats.bolditalic=ZapfDingbats |
| 128 |
# |
| 129 |
sansserif.latin1.plain=Helvetica |
| 130 |
sansserif.latin1.bold=Helvetica-Bold |
| 131 |
sansserif.latin1.italic=Helvetica-Oblique |
| 132 |
sansserif.latin1.bolditalic=Helvetica-BoldOblique |
| 133 |
sansserif.symbol.plain=Symbol |
| 134 |
sansserif.dingbats.plain=ZapfDingbats |
| 135 |
sansserif.symbol.bold=Symbol |
| 136 |
sansserif.dingbats.bold=ZapfDingbats |
| 137 |
sansserif.symbol.italic=Symbol |
| 138 |
sansserif.dingbats.italic=ZapfDingbats |
| 139 |
sansserif.symbol.bolditalic=Symbol |
| 140 |
sansserif.dingbats.bolditalic=ZapfDingbats |
| 141 |
# |
| 142 |
monospaced.latin1.plain=Courier |
| 143 |
monospaced.latin1.bold=Courier-Bold |
| 144 |
monospaced.latin1.italic=Courier-Oblique |
| 145 |
monospaced.latin1.bolditalic=Courier-BoldOblique |
| 146 |
monospaced.symbol.plain=Symbol |
| 147 |
monospaced.dingbats.plain=ZapfDingbats |
| 148 |
monospaced.symbol.bold=Symbol |
| 149 |
monospaced.dingbats.bold=ZapfDingbats |
| 150 |
monospaced.symbol.italic=Symbol |
| 151 |
monospaced.dingbats.italic=ZapfDingbats |
| 152 |
monospaced.symbol.bolditalic=Symbol |
| 153 |
monospaced.dingbats.bolditalic=ZapfDingbats |
| 154 |
# |
| 155 |
# Next the mapping of the font name + charset + style to Postscript font name |
| 156 |
# for the physical fonts. Since these always report style as plain, the |
| 157 |
# style key is always plain. So we map using the face name to the correct |
| 158 |
# style for the postscript font. This is possible since the face names can |
| 159 |
# be replied upon to be different for each style. |
| 160 |
# However an application may try to create a Font applying a style to an |
| 161 |
# physical name. We want to map to the correct Postscript font there too |
| 162 |
# if possible but we do not map cases where the application tries to |
| 163 |
# augment a style (eg ask for a bold version of a bold font) |
| 164 |
# Defer to the 2D package to attempt create an artificially styled version |
| 165 |
# |
| 166 |
avantgarde_book.latin1.plain=AvantGarde-Book |
| 167 |
avantgarde_demi.latin1.plain=AvantGarde-Demi |
| 168 |
avantgarde_book_oblique.latin1.plain=AvantGarde-BookOblique |
| 169 |
avantgarde_demi_oblique.latin1.plain=AvantGarde-DemiOblique |
| 170 |
# |
| 171 |
avantgarde_book.latin1.bold=AvantGarde-Demi |
| 172 |
avantgarde_book.latin1.italic=AvantGarde-BookOblique |
| 173 |
avantgarde_book.latin1.bolditalic=AvantGarde-DemiOblique |
| 174 |
avantgarde_demi.latin1.italic=AvantGarde-DemiOblique |
| 175 |
avantgarde_book_oblique.latin1.bold=AvantGarde-DemiOblique |
| 176 |
# |
| 177 |
bookman_light.latin1.plain=Bookman-Light |
| 178 |
bookman_demi.latin1.plain=Bookman-Demi |
| 179 |
bookman_light_italic.latin1.plain=Bookman-LightItalic |
| 180 |
bookman_demi_italic.latin1.plain=Bookman-DemiItalic |
| 181 |
# |
| 182 |
bookman_light.latin1.bold=Bookman-Demi |
| 183 |
bookman_light.latin1.italic=Bookman-LightItalic |
| 184 |
bookman_light.latin1.bolditalic=Bookman-DemiItalic |
| 185 |
bookman_light_bold.latin1.italic=Bookman-DemiItalic |
| 186 |
bookman_light_italic.latin1.bold=Bookman-DemiItalic |
| 187 |
# |
| 188 |
courier.latin1.plain=Courier |
| 189 |
courier_bold.latin1.plain=Courier-Bold |
| 190 |
courier_oblique.latin1.plain=Courier-Oblique |
| 191 |
courier_bold_oblique.latin1.plain=Courier-BoldOblique |
| 192 |
courier.latin1.bold=Courier-Bold |
| 193 |
courier.latin1.italic=Courier-Oblique |
| 194 |
courier.latin1.bolditalic=Courier-BoldOblique |
| 195 |
courier_bold.latin1.italic=Courier-BoldOblique |
| 196 |
courier_italic.latin1.bold=Courier-BoldOblique |
| 197 |
# |
| 198 |
helvetica_bold.latin1.plain=Helvetica-Bold |
| 199 |
helvetica_oblique.latin1.plain=Helvetica-Oblique |
| 200 |
helvetica_bold_oblique.latin1.plain=Helvetica-BoldOblique |
| 201 |
helvetica.latin1.bold=Helvetica-Bold |
| 202 |
helvetica.latin1.italic=Helvetica-Oblique |
| 203 |
helvetica.latin1.bolditalic=Helvetica-BoldOblique |
| 204 |
helvetica_bold.latin1.italic=Helvetica-BoldOblique |
| 205 |
helvetica_italic.latin1.bold=Helvetica-BoldOblique |
| 206 |
# |
| 207 |
newcenturyschoolbook.latin1.plain=NewCenturySchlbk-Roman |
| 208 |
newcenturyschoolbook_bold.latin1.plain=NewCenturySchlbk-Bold |
| 209 |
newcenturyschoolbook_italic.latin1.plain=NewCenturySchlbk-Italic |
| 210 |
newcenturyschoolbook_bold_italic.latin1.plain=NewCenturySchlbk-BoldItalic |
| 211 |
newcenturyschoolbook.latin1.bold=NewCenturySchlbk-Bold |
| 212 |
newcenturyschoolbook.latin1.italic=NewCenturySchlbk-Italic |
| 213 |
newcenturyschoolbook.latin1.bolditalic=NewCenturySchlbk-BoldItalic |
| 214 |
newcenturyschoolbook_bold.latin1.italic=NewCenturySchlbk-BoldItalic |
| 215 |
newcenturyschoolbook_italic.latin1.bold=NewCenturySchlbk-BoldItalic |
| 216 |
# |
| 217 |
palatino.latin1.plain=Palatino-Roman |
| 218 |
palatino_bold.latin1.plain=Palatino-Bold |
| 219 |
palatino_italic.latin1.plain=Palatino-Italic |
| 220 |
palatino_bold_italic.latin1.plain=Palatino-BoldItalic |
| 221 |
palatino.latin1.bold=Palatino-Bold |
| 222 |
palatino.latin1.italic=Palatino-Italic |
| 223 |
palatino.latin1.bolditalic=Palatino-BoldItalic |
| 224 |
palatino_bold.latin1.italic=Palatino-BoldItalic |
| 225 |
palatino_italic.latin1.bold=Palatino-BoldItalic |
| 226 |
# |
| 227 |
times_roman.latin1.plain=Times-Roman |
| 228 |
times_roman_bold.latin1.plain=Times-Bold |
| 229 |
times_roman_italic.latin1.plain=Times-Italic |
| 230 |
times_roman_bold_italic.latin1.plain=Times-BoldItalic |
| 231 |
times_roman.latin1.bold=Times-Bold |
| 232 |
times_roman.latin1.italic=Times-Italic |
| 233 |
times_roman.latin1.bolditalic=Times-BoldItalic |
| 234 |
times_roman_bold.latin1.italic=Times-BoldItalic |
| 235 |
times_roman_italic.latin1.bold=Times-BoldItalic |
| 236 |
# |
| 237 |
zapfchancery_italic.latin1.plain=ZapfChancery-MediumItalic |
| 238 |
# |
| 239 |
# Finally the mappings of PS font names to indexes. |
| 240 |
# |
| 241 |
AvantGarde-Book=0 |
| 242 |
AvantGarde-BookOblique=1 |
| 243 |
AvantGarde-Demi=2 |
| 244 |
AvantGarde-DemiOblique=3 |
| 245 |
Bookman-Demi=4 |
| 246 |
Bookman-DemiItalic=5 |
| 247 |
Bookman-Light=6 |
| 248 |
Bookman-LightItalic=7 |
| 249 |
Courier=8 |
| 250 |
Courier-Bold=9 |
| 251 |
Courier-BoldOblique=10 |
| 252 |
Courier-Oblique=11 |
| 253 |
Helvetica=12 |
| 254 |
Helvetica-Bold=13 |
| 255 |
Helvetica-BoldOblique=14 |
| 256 |
Helvetica-Narrow=15 |
| 257 |
Helvetica-Narrow-Bold=16 |
| 258 |
Helvetica-Narrow-BoldOblique=17 |
| 259 |
Helvetica-Narrow-Oblique=18 |
| 260 |
Helvetica-Oblique=19 |
| 261 |
NewCenturySchlbk-Bold=20 |
| 262 |
NewCenturySchlbk-BoldItalic=21 |
| 263 |
NewCenturySchlbk-Italic=22 |
| 264 |
NewCenturySchlbk-Roman=23 |
| 265 |
Palatino-Bold=24 |
| 266 |
Palatino-BoldItalic=25 |
| 267 |
Palatino-Italic=26 |
| 268 |
Palatino-Roman=27 |
| 269 |
Symbol=28 |
| 270 |
Times-Bold=29 |
| 271 |
Times-BoldItalic=30 |
| 272 |
Times-Italic=31 |
| 273 |
Times-Roman=32 |
| 274 |
ZapfDingbats=33 |
| 275 |
ZapfChancery-MediumItalic=34 |
| 276 |
# |
| 277 |
font.0=AvantGarde-Book ISOF |
| 278 |
font.1=AvantGarde-BookOblique ISOF |
| 279 |
font.2=AvantGarde-Demi ISOF |
| 280 |
font.3=AvantGarde-DemiOblique ISOF |
| 281 |
font.4=Bookman-Demi ISOF |
| 282 |
font.5=Bookman-DemiItalic ISOF |
| 283 |
font.6=Bookman-Light ISOF |
| 284 |
font.7=Bookman-LightItalic ISOF |
| 285 |
font.8=Courier ISOF |
| 286 |
font.9=Courier-Bold ISOF |
| 287 |
font.10=Courier-BoldOblique ISOF |
| 288 |
font.11=Courier-Oblique ISOF |
| 289 |
font.12=Helvetica ISOF |
| 290 |
font.13=Helvetica-Bold ISOF |
| 291 |
font.14=Helvetica-BoldOblique ISOF |
| 292 |
font.15=Helvetica-Narrow ISOF |
| 293 |
font.16=Helvetica-Narrow-Bold ISOF |
| 294 |
font.17=Helvetica-Narrow-BoldOblique ISOF |
| 295 |
font.18=Helvetica-Narrow-Oblique ISOF |
| 296 |
font.19=Helvetica-Oblique ISOF |
| 297 |
font.20=NewCenturySchlbk-Bold ISOF |
| 298 |
font.21=NewCenturySchlbk-BoldItalic ISOF |
| 299 |
font.22=NewCenturySchlbk-Italic ISOF |
| 300 |
font.23=NewCenturySchlbk-Roman ISOF |
| 301 |
font.24=Palatino-Bold ISOF |
| 302 |
font.25=Palatino-BoldItalic ISOF |
| 303 |
font.26=Palatino-Italic ISOF |
| 304 |
font.27=Palatino-Roman ISOF |
| 305 |
font.28=Symbol findfont |
| 306 |
font.29=Times-Bold ISOF |
| 307 |
font.30=Times-BoldItalic ISOF |
| 308 |
font.31=Times-Italic ISOF |
| 309 |
font.32=Times-Roman ISOF |
| 310 |
font.33=ZapfDingbats findfont |
| 311 |
font.34=ZapfChancery-MediumItalic ISOF |
| 312 |
# |